I got a question along these lines. I will be taking my class from a range that specifically states that they do not provide the packet. So how do I get it from the DPS? Do I fill out the forms online and pay the $140 and then they mail it to me, or what?

That is exactly what you do. You will usually get your package in the mail in about a week.

Before you take that class though, think about this... if you go to the class without your packet in hand then you will be left to fill out the fingerprint cards, photo card, and affidavits on your own. No one will check your packet for accuracy or completeness.

Sorry, kauboy, I misread your question. I thought you were taking the class this weekend, in which case you would not have your packet before you attended the class.

So, yes, the DPS will know you have already paid. You will receive an application already filled out with the information you gave them online. They will also send you the fingerprint cards, photo card, and affidavits.

All you do is fill out the rest in class, add your TR-100 (provided by your instructor) and send it all back to DPS.
